- Guide a teaching team to develop classroom plans, goals, and lead hands-on activities based on your observations of the children's interests and needs.
- Communicate daily with parents. Document and share the important milestones in their child's day.
- Keep the classroom safe and clean by following important procedures and guidelines.
- Candidates must pass required state and company background checks, and meet state and company minimum education and experience requirements:
- At least 18 years of age with a high school diploma or GED required
- CDA or higher level of education required
- At least six months of experience working in child care, daycare, or preschool required
- 12 Child Development units completed required:
Child Development, Child, Family, and Community, Introduction to Curriculum, and Principles and Practices. If applying for an Infant or Toddler position, Infant and Toddler Development class is required as one of the curriculum courses - Transcripts will be required at time of hire
- AA/BA in Early Childhood Education preferred
